RBC Capital Markets Cuts RatingOn Procter & Gamble’s Stock

Author Image

By: TOM BRANNA

Editor

• RBC Capital Markets downgraded Procter & Gamble Co to “sector perform” from “outperform,” expressing doubts over the management’s ability to execute a recent plan to cut costs and drive growth for its key businesses.
